Telegram founder Pavel Durov has succeeded in having his judicial supervision measures lifted, according to French media reports, including Agence France-Presse.
According to sources, the restrictions that barred Durov from leaving France and required him to report regularly to a police station in Nice have now been removed.
The reports say Durov “fully complied” with all conditions of his judicial oversight. Bloomberg also confirmed that French authorities lifted his travel ban entirely as of November 10.
What it means
Law enforcement had been examining whether Durov could be considered complicit in crimes committed through the messaging platform. He had initially been ordered to remain in France.
In June, Durov succeeded in having some of the restrictions eased, allowing limited travel to Dubai. The travel ban has now been lifted completely, though the broader investigation continues.
